本文作者:admin

ssh查看服务器配置?

芯岁网络 2024-10-26 08:37 0 0条评论

一、ssh查看服务器配置?

要查看SSH服务器的配置,你可以按照以下步骤进行操作:

使用SSH客户端连接到服务器。你可以使用命令行工具如OpenSSH的ssh命令来连接。在终端中运行以下命令,将your_username替换为你的用户名,your_server_ip替换为服务器的IP地址:

bash

复制

ssh your_username@your_server_ip

然后按照提示输入服务器上的用户密码,以完成连接。

连接成功后,你可以在服务器的命令行终端上运行一些命令来查看服务器配置。

查看SSH服务状态:运行以下命令来检查SSH服务是否正在运行:

复制

bash`sudo service ssh status`

如果SSH服务正在运行,你将看到一条消息指示服务正在运行。

查看SSH配置文件:SSH服务器的配置文件通常位于/etc/ssh/sshd_config。你可以使用文本编辑器(如vi或nano)打开该文件以查看配置选项。例如,使用vi编辑器打开文件:

复制

bash`sudo vi /etc/ssh/sshd_config`

在编辑器中,你可以浏览和查看各种SSH配置选项,如端口号、允许的用户、密码认证等。

查看SSH日志:SSH服务器通常会将日志记录到系统日志文件中。你可以使用grep命令来搜索SSH相关的日志条目。例如,运行以下命令来搜索SSH登录尝试的日志:

复制

bash`sudo grep ssh /var/log/auth.log`

这将显示与SSH登录尝试相关的日志条目,你可以从中获取有关服务器配置和连接尝试的信息。

请注意,执行上述操作需要具有适当的权限。如果你没有足够的权限,你可能需要使用sudo命令以管理员身份运行这些命令。

此外,不同的服务器和操作系统可能会有所不同,因此具体的命令和路径可能会有所变化。建议查阅服务器的文档或参考相关资源,以获取针对你的特定环境的准确指导。

二、如何配置ssh客户端,怎么ssh连接Linux服务器?

在Linuxe服务器上开启远程和端口。内网的话直接用地址加端口即可连接。 外网需要做端口映射。

1.开启ssh(secure shell)服务(我的是linux ubuntu 10.10),当然在开启ssh服务之前,需要下载相关得软件,使用下面得命令即可: sudo apt-get install ssh 然后进入/etc/init.d 输入命令:sudo service ssh start 开启ssh服务 使用 netstat -tln 查看ssh服务是否已经打开(ssh 服务默认使用22端口) 若要关闭ssh服务时,使用 : sudo service ssh stop即可关闭ssh 服务

2.在客户端(widnows主机)上下载ssh客户端putty,填写linux服务器ip,session name 然后保存,打开,输入用户名,和密码,那么就登录成功了

三、centos7配置ssh服务器

CentOS 7配置SSH服务器

CentOS 7 是广泛采用的稳定且安全的服务器操作系统。配置 SSH(Secure Shell)服务器是在CentOS 7上建立安全远程连接的关键步骤。本文将详细介绍如何在CentOS 7上配置SSH服务器,确保您的服务器通信安全可靠。

安装OpenSSH

SSH服务器在CentOS 7中通过OpenSSH实现。要安装OpenSSH,确保您的系统已连接到互联网,并执行以下命令:

yum install openssh-server

启动SSH服务

安装完成后,您需要启动SSH服务。执行以下命令启用SSH服务并设置开机自启:

systemctl start sshd
systemctl enable sshd

配置SSH

配置文件位于 /etc/ssh/sshd_config。通过编辑此文件,您可以自定义SSH服务器的各种设置。一些常见的配置包括:

  • 更改SSH端口
  • 限制登录用户
  • 禁用root用户登录
  • 启用公钥身份验证

更改SSH端口

默认情况下,SSH服务器监听端口为22。为增加安全性,建议更改为非标准端口。通过编辑配置文件中的 Port 指令,更改端口号:

Port 2222

限制登录用户

您可以限制哪些用户可以使用SSH登录到服务器。通过使用 AllowUsers 指令,您可以指定允许访问SSH的用户列表:

AllowUsers user1 user2

禁用root用户登录

禁用root用户直接登录服务器有助于提高安全性。通过编辑配置文件,找到 PermitRootLogin 并将其设置为 no

PermitRootLogin no

启用公钥身份验证

使用公钥身份验证可以提供更强的安全性,建议您启用此功能。确保您的公钥已添加到 ~/.ssh/authorized_keys 文件,然后启用 PubkeyAuthentication

PubkeyAuthentication yes

重启SSH服务

当您完成对配置文件的更改后,别忘记重启SSH服务以使更改生效:

systemctl restart sshd

连接SSH服务器

现在您已成功配置SSH服务器,可以使用SSH客户端连接。在终端输入以下命令连接到服务器:

ssh user@your_server_ip -p 2222

输入您的密码(如果已启用密码验证)或者按照配置使用私钥进行连接。如果成功连接,恭喜您已完成配置的CentOS 7 SSH服务器。

总结

通过本文介绍的步骤,您已了解如何在CentOS 7上配置SSH服务器。通过更改端口、限制用户、禁用root登录以及启用公钥身份验证,可以加强服务器的安全性,并确保远程连接的安全可靠性。

四、ssh配置步骤?

配置SSH的步骤如下:

1. 安装SSH服务器软件,如OpenSSH。

2. 打开SSH服务器配置文件,通常位于/etc/ssh/sshd_config。

3. 根据需要修改配置文件,例如更改端口号、禁用root登录等。

4. 保存并关闭配置文件。

5. 启动SSH服务器,可以使用命令sudo service ssh start。

6. 配置防火墙以允许SSH连接,通常需要打开端口号22。

7. 在客户端上安装SSH客户端软件,如OpenSSH。

8. 打开SSH客户端,使用命令ssh username@hostname连接到SSH服务器。

9. 输入密码或使用SSH密钥进行身份验证。

10. 成功连接到SSH服务器后,可以执行远程操作,如文件传输、远程命令执行等。

五、VPS服务器如何配置SSH进行代理上网?

方法很简单,几行命令搞定。主要原理就是在你的VPS上建一个受限的VPS用户,此用户仅作SSH上网用,对ROOT账户或安装的VPN没有丝毫影响。添加账号方法1、Putty登录 VPS输入以下命令:SSH root@123.123.123.123记得将 123.123.123.123″ 替换成你VPS的IP地址。

2、创建一个用户组输入以下命令:groupadd username你可以将 username 替换成任意你容易记住名字。

3、创建受限用户输入以下命令:useradd -d /home/username -m -g username -s /bin/false username4、为新用户设置密码输入以下命令:passwd username回车,输入密码,回车,再输入一次密码,回车。

六、Linux系统下如何配置SSH?如何开启SSH?

1、如何查看linux操作系统版本

打开linux终端命令行,输入如下命令即可。lsb_release -a。采用的是实体机服务器,操作系统为redhat6.7,详细请看下图。

2、如何查看SSH服务是否已经安装

在终端命令行执行。rpm -qa | grep "ssh"。执行结果请看下图,说明已经安装;其实在安装linux操作系统的时候默认就会安装上的。

3、如果SSH服务没有安装怎么办

找到操作系统镜像文件解压,找到ssh相关的包,上传到服务器。然后执行如下安装命令安装即可。rpm -ivh rpm包名。如果服务器挂载了镜像,可以直接采用如下命令安装也可以。yum install ssh。这里因为我的linux服务器已经安装SSH,就不在做安装操作了。

4、如何启动SSH服务

启动命令,service sshd start。停止命令,service sshd stop。重启命令,service sshd restart。首先我们来看看SSH服务是否启动了,请执行如下命令即可,service sshd status。如果想重新启动一下,可以执行重启命令,service sshd restart。具体执行情况请看下图。

5、怎么查看SSH端口是多少

执行如下命令,more /etc/ssh/sshd_config。就可以查看到有说明,默认端口为22,具体如下图所示。另外端口是可以修改的。

6、如何配置开启SSH服务,有两种方案

1、关闭防火墙执行如下命令,service iptables stop

2、就是放开22端口,vi /etc/sysconfig/iptables,在iptables文件中加上这一行即可,-A INPUT -m state --state NEW -m tcp -p tcp --dport 22 -j ACCEPT。请看下图操作所示。

七、两台Linux服务器,ssh代理上网配置?

A服务器配置两块网卡,其中一块网卡配置接入外网,一块网卡配置接入内网,而B服务器就接入在与A在同一网络的内网上,在A服务器上通过squid配置透明代理就可以,同时做iptables数据转发处理,B服务器的网关需要配置为服务器A的内网口IP地址,这些都可以通过命令行完成。

八、centos git ssh配置

CentOS Git SSH配置指南

在CentOS上配置Git与SSH是一个常见且重要的任务,特别是对于开发人员和系统管理员来说。本文将为您提供详细的步骤和指导,帮助您在CentOS系统上成功配置Git和SSH。

安装Git

首先,我们需要确保在CentOS系统上安装了Git。您可以通过运行以下命令来检查Git是否已安装:

git --version

如果Git已安装,您将看到安装的Git版本信息。如果Git尚未安装,您可以使用以下命令安装Git:

yum install git

生成SSH密钥

接下来,我们需要生成SSH密钥,以便将其与Git存储库进行身份验证。您可以通过以下步骤生成SSH密钥:

  1. 打开终端并运行以下命令:
  2. ssh-keygen -t rsa -b 4096 -C "your_email@example.com"
  3. 按照提示输入要保存密钥的文件名,或直接按Enter接受默认文件名。
  4. 设置您的SSH密钥的密码,以增加安全性。

将SSH密钥添加到SSH代理

为了便于身份验证,我们可以将生成的SSH密钥添加到SSH代理中。您可以通过以下步骤完成此操作:

eval "$(ssh-agent -s)"
ssh-add ~/.ssh/id_rsa

将SSH密钥添加到Git帐户

最后一步是将生成的SSH密钥添加到您的Git帐户中。您可以通过以下步骤完成此操作:

  1. 复制SSH密钥至剪贴板:
  2. cat ~/.ssh/id_rsa.pub
  3. 登录到您的Git帐户,转到设置中的SSH和GPG密钥部分。
  4. 添加新的SSH密钥,并将剪贴板中复制的内容粘贴到指定区域。

配置Git全局参数

在成功配置SSH密钥后,还可以设置Git的全局参数,以便标识开发人员信息。您可以通过以下命令设置全局参数:

git config --global user.name "Your Name"
git config --global user.email "your_email@example.com"

验证SSH连接

最后,为了确保一切配置正确,您可以通过以下命令验证SSH连接是否正常:

ssh -T git@github.com

如果一切正常,您将看到来自Git的欢迎信息。

总结

通过本文提供的步骤和指南,您应该能够在CentOS系统上成功配置Git与SSH,并能够顺利与Git存储库进行通信。这些配置对于开发工作和项目管理至关重要,希望本文对您有所帮助。

九、centos 6.5 配置ssh

CentOS 6.5 配置SSH

今天我们将讨论如何在 CentOS 6.5 系统上配置 SSH。SSH(Secure Shell)是一种加密网络协议,用于在不安全的网络上安全地操作网络服务。在服务器管理和远程连接中,SSH 扮演着关键的角色。让我们深入研究如何正确配置SSH,以确保系统安全性。

安装 OpenSSH

要在 CentOS 6.5 上配置 SSH,首先需要安装 OpenSSH。OpenSSH 是 SSH 协议的免费开源实现,为安全远程访问提供了强大的加密功能。

yum install openssh-server

通过上述命令,您可以使用 yum 包管理器安装 OpenSSH 服务器组件。安装完成后,您可以对 SSH 进行进一步配置。

配置SSH

一旦 OpenSSH 安装完成,我们需要对其进行配置。SSH 配置文件位于 /etc/ssh/sshd_config。通过编辑此文件,可以自定义 SSH 的各种设置。

以下是一些常见的 SSH 配置选项:

  • Port: SSH 服务器监听的端口,默认为 22。您可以更改端口以增强安全性。
  • PermitRootLogin: 控制是否允许 root 用户直接登录。建议禁用此选项,使用普通用户登录后再切换到 root。
  • PasswordAuthentication: 确定是否允许密码身份验证。建议启用公钥身份验证以提高安全性。
  • AllowUsers: 限制可以通过 SSH 登录的用户列表。

编辑 /etc/ssh/sshd_config 文件,并根据您的需求更改这些选项。在保存更改后,重新启动 SSH 服务以使更改生效。

service sshd restart

防火墙配置

为确保 SSH 的安全性,我们还需要确认防火墙已正确配置以允许 SSH 连接。在 CentOS 6.5 中,我们可以使用 iptables 进行防火墙配置。

以下命令将允许传入的 SSH 连接:

iptables -A INPUT -p tcp --dport 22 -j ACCEPT
service iptables save

通过上述命令,我们打开了 22 端口,允许传入的 SSH 连接。确保在配置完 iptables 后保存设置以便重启后生效。

连接服务器

现在,您已成功配置了 SSH,可以使用 SSH 客户端连接到您的 CentOS 6.5 服务器。在终端或命令提示符中,使用以下命令连接到服务器:

ssh username@server_ip

请将 username 替换为您的用户名,server_ip 替换为服务器的 IP 地址。在第一次连接时,您会收到关于服务器密钥的提示,输入 yes 确认并建立连接。

输入您的密码或私钥密码(如果使用密钥身份验证),您将成功登录到服务器。现在,您可以在远程服务器上执行命令和管理您的系统了。

总结

在本文中,我们讨论了在 CentOS 6.5 系统上配置 SSH 的过程。通过安装 OpenSSH、编辑配置文件、设置防火墙规则和建立连接,您已经学会了如何安全地管理远程服务器。确保始终关注系统安全性,并采取适当的安全措施,以保护服务器免受潜在威胁。

希望这个教程对您有所帮助。祝您在 CentOS 6.5 上配置 SSH 顺利!

十、centos 6.5 ssh配置

CentOS 6.5 SSH配置

CentOS 6.5 SSH配置指南

在CentOS 6.5上进行SSH配置是确保服务器安全性的重要步骤之一。SSH(Secure Shell)是一种网络协议,可通过加密通道在网络上安全地传输数据。通过正确配置SSH,您可以防止未经授权的访问并提高系统安全性。

安装OpenSSH

在开始配置SSH之前,确保系统已安装OpenSSH软件包。您可以通过以下命令安装OpenSSH:

yum install openssh-server

修改SSH配置文件

要修改SSH配置文件,请编辑/etc/ssh/sshd_config文件。使用编辑器打开文件并进行必要的更改:

vim /etc/ssh/sshd_config

在文件中,您可以设置各种参数来增强SSH安全性,例如修改端口、禁用root登录、限制用户访问等。

设置SSH端口

默认情况下,SSH服务器使用22端口。为了提高安全性,建议将端口更改为非标准端口。您可以在配置文件中找到以下行并修改端口号:

Port 2222

禁用Root登录

禁止root用户直接登录是另一个重要的安全措施。搜索PermitRootLogin并将其值更改为no

PermitRootLogin no

限制用户访问

您还可以限制哪些用户可以访问SSH服务器。通过编辑AllowUsers行后,添加允许访问的用户名列表:

AllowUsers user1 user2

重启SSH服务

完成对配置文件的修改后,保存更改并重新启动SSH服务以使更改生效:

service sshd restart

防火墙设置

最后,确保防火墙允许新的SSH端口访问。使用以下命令添加防火墙规则:

firewall-cmd --zone=public --add-port=2222/tcp --permanent

重启防火墙以使更改生效:

firewall-cmd --reload

总结

通过对CentOS 6.5的SSH进行正确配置,您可以大大提高服务器的安全性。确保时刻关注安全最佳实践,并保持系统更新是保护系统免受潜在威胁的关键。